libertas: fix pointer bugs for PS_MODE commands
struct cmd_ds_802_11_ps_mode contains the command header and a pointer to it was initialized with data points to the body which leads to mis-interpretation of the cmd_ds_802_11_ps_mode.action member. cmd[0] contains the header, &cmd[1] points beyond that. cmdnode->cmdbuf is a pointer to the command buffer This piece of code was unused since power saving was not enabled.
